Feyenoord host Ajax in an Eredivisie fixture on Sunday as they look to continue their pursuit of leaders PSV Eindhoven. Ajax are still a bit out of sorts and should find things difficult against Feyenoord, who often do their best work at home.

Feyenoord head into Sunday’s clash off the back of a 0-0 draw with Volendam in their previous Eredivisie fixture. They dominated the possession and had multiple attempts on target but lacked the cutting edge in attack.

While manager Arne Slot will be disappointed not to have matched the performance with a win, the result extends Feyenoord’s unbeaten run to seven fixtures. They have picked up five wins in that run and are second on the Eredivisie standings, nine points off the pace.

One constant aspect of Feyenoord’s campaign is that they often do their best work at De Kuip having suffered just one Eredivisie home defeat all season. They have won their last four home matches and claimed a 4-2 victory over Utrecht in their previous fixture in front of their fans.

Ajax are also coming off a draw as they were held to a 1-1 scoreline by Go Ahead Eagles last time out in the Eredivisie. They struck first through Anton Gaaei and held on for long periods before conceding a late equaliser.

That result means Ajax have now picked up just one win in their last six matches across all competitions. They have drawn four times in that run and are currently fifth on the standings, well behind the front runners.

Ajax claimed a 3-1 victory over PEC Zwolle in their previous fixture on the road, although that was the first win in their last four away matches. John van’t Schip’s men have also struggled to maintain their discipline at the back and are without a clean sheet in their last 13 away matches across all competitions.

Head to head

Ajax have a 40-10 advantage with 18 draws from 68 previous matches against Feyenoord. However, Feyenoord have won two of the last three meetings and claimed a 4-0 victory in the reverse fixture back in September with Santiago Gimenez netting a hat-trick.
